Deflector, tie rod dust
Part number: 4036535100
Price: USD 7.00 /Unit
Brand: Geely
Add to cart
Add to Watchlist
Brand: Geely
Features & Benefits
Related Factories
Anhui wanzhuo auto parts co., ltd.
Beijing Century Hezheng International Trade Co., Ltd.